Description

Nursing Reference Center™ (NRC) is a comprehensive reference tool designed to provide relevant clinical resources to nurses, directly at the point-of-care. This free app is available for staff nurses, nurse administrators, nursing students, nurse faculty and hospital librarians with an institutional subscription to NRC. It offers the best available and most recent clinical evidence from thousands of full-text documents. The convenience and rich functionality of the app gives users access to: ∙ NRC content offline ∙ Clinically organized quick lessons ∙ Evidence-based care sheets ∙ Point-of-care drug information ∙ Nursing Practice & Skills ∙ Skill Competency Checklists ∙ Automatically saved 25 most recent searches To use the NRC app, you must obtain an access key. Access Nursing Reference Center or Nursing Reference Center Plus online through your institution as you typically would and click the link at the bottom of the page to email yourself the key.
